Review of Cars 3 (2017) by Farah R — 10 Nov 2017
A great improvement in both story and animation from its predecessor, but still remains an entry in Pixar's weakest franchise. Cars 3 is the latest and hopefully final installment in the Cars franchise as it's indeed time to bring down the curtain on this trilogy that should never have surpassed the first movie.
But obviously the other two were only getting made to make big bucks. Unfortunately though, that's how most Hollywood films are getting made today proving that terrible reviews can still be profitable.
Coming back to the film, it's evident that the directors and writers understood what went wrong in Cars 2 and came back with a coherent plot that focuses on the main character and a new, more mature challenge that he must overcome.
It's also clear that McQuean's story has come to an end and it was a satisfying closure for all.
